Title :
Single-cycle resonant converter families for high performance DC/DC power conversion

Abstract :
A novel zero-voltage switching/zero-current switching (ZVS/ZCS) single-cycle resonant converter (SCRC) family based on the ZVS/ZCS single-cycle resonant switch is proposed to complement the ZCS/ZVS SCRC reported by J.G. Cho and G.H. Cho (Proc. ISPE, pp. 259-66, May 1989: IEEE Trans. Ind. Electron., vol.38, no.4, pp.260-7, Aug. 1991). These SCRC families are similar in characteristics to full-wave ZVS and ZCS quasi-resonant converter (QRC) families. However, SCRCs are capable of achieving ZCS/ZVS operation from no-load to full-load as opposed to the limited load range in QRCs. Also. the degrading efficiency of full-wave QRCs under light load condition is improved in SCRCs. The operation, analysis, and design of SCRCs are much simpler than those of QRCs and are discussed. The DC conversion characteristics and small-signal transfer functions of SCRCs are similar to those of their PWM (pulse-width-modulation) counterparts. Experimental results supporting the proposed concept are included
